How Our Sewage Water Extraction Process Works

Our team’s process for sewage water extraction is designed to get your home back to normal as quickly and safely as possible. We understand that every minute counts when dealing with sewage water, which is why we’ve developed a comprehensive approach to ensure that every step of the process is handled with care and attention to detail.

Step 1: Containment

Our technicians will arrive at your home and begin by containing the sewage water to prevent further damage. This involves setting up barriers and containment systems to keep the water from spreading to other areas of your property. We’ll also take the time to identify and address any potential safety hazards, such as electrical or gas leaks.

Step 2: Extraction

Once the containment system is in place, our technicians will begin the extraction process using advanced equipment designed to safely and efficiently remove sewage water from your home. This may involve using truck-mounted pumps, portable extractors, or other specialized equipment to remove the water and any contaminants.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

After the sewage water has been extracted, our technicians will focus on drying and dehumidifying the affected areas. This involves using industrial-strength fans, dehumidifiers, and other equipment to remove any remaining moisture and prevent further damage.

Step 4: Sanitizing and Cleaning

Once the affected areas have been dried and dehumidified, our technicians will begin the sanitizing and cleaning process. This involves using specialized equipment and cleaning solutions to remove any remaining contaminants and odors.

Step 5: Inspection and Restoration

Finally, our technicians will conduct a thorough inspection of the affected areas to ensure that all contaminants and moisture have been removed. We’ll also work with you to develop a plan for any necessary repairs or restorations to get your home back to its original condition.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ost in Pearland, TX

The cost of sewage water extraction in Pearland, TX, can v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. The prices listed below are estimates and may vary based on your specific situ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Containment and extraction $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age.
Drying and dehumidification $500 – $1,500 Size of affected area and duration of drying process.
Sanitizing and cleaning $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area and extent of cleaning required.
Inspection and restoration $500 – $2,000 Severity of damage and extent of repairs required.
